Структура PHONEEXTENSIONID (tapi.h)
Структура PHONEEXTENSIONID описывает идентификатор расширения. Идентификаторы расширений используются для идентификации расширений для конкретных поставщиков услуг для классов телефонных устройств. Функции phoneNegotiateAPIVersion и TSPI_phoneGetExtensionID возвращают эту структуру.
Синтаксис
typedef struct phoneextensionid_tag {
DWORD dwExtensionID0;
DWORD dwExtensionID1;
DWORD dwExtensionID2;
DWORD dwExtensionID3;
} PHONEEXTENSIONID, *LPPHONEEXTENSIONID;
Члены
dwExtensionID0
Первая часть идентификатора расширения.
dwExtensionID1
Вторая часть идентификатора расширения.
dwExtensionID2
Третья часть идентификатора расширения.
dwExtensionID3
Четвертая часть идентификатора расширения.
Комментарии
Эти четыре элемента вместе задают универсальный уникальный идентификатор расширения, который идентифицирует расширение класса телефонного устройства. Эта структура не может быть расширена.
Идентификаторы расширений создаются с помощью служебной программы создания, предоставленной пакетом SDK.
Требования
Требование | Значение |
---|---|
Заголовок | tapi.h |